Summing up the tax liens and deeds seminar

  • Dont waste your money on this seminar. It just did not deliver.
  • If you only have a very small amount of time available to learn this business then it is not for you. It does have opportunity but it does have lots of pitfalls if you do not do it right!
  • You will not learn all you need to know at the 2 day seminar. Remember Tommy Senatore recommends you spend at least 10 hours a week and he's an expert!
  • You need more than the $12 Dan Eckleman tells you you need to get started if you want any sort of decent return.
  • If you are keen to learn about tax liens and deeds then do plenty of research on the internet as there are lots of competitvely priced training packages you can buy. From my research they look to deliver at least as much as the Dane academy seminar and many are around half the cost.
  • If you still really want to do this seminar then do the one these guys offer on line - it has money back guarantees unlike the 24 hr deal you get if you do the live seminar. You can find the details at this website. Please note that you are buying from a US company.
  • Get the report from Gilligan Rowe.
  • Do lots of research first and see what other people who have been to the seminars have said on the various forums.
  • Have some morals and don't rip people off by getting into the overbids scheme.
I hope these posts have given you an idea of my experience and hopefully after reading them you will not make the same mistakes I had.
